Bed-jacket vs Bog Pine
Alectryon tomentosus compared with Halocarpus bidwillii
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bed-jacket | Bog Pine |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Coniferophyta (Conifers)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Pinopsida (Conifers) |
| Order | Sapindales (Sapindales) | Pinales (Pines & Allies) |
| Family | Sapindaceae | Podocarpaceae |
| Genus | Alectryon | Halocarpus |
| Species | Alectryon tomentosus | Halocarpus bidwillii |
Evolutionary Relationship
Bed-jacket and Bog Pine share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Plantae. (Plants)
